August weather forecast
Khalouia, Algeria

August

Weather in August

The last month of the summer, August, is a torrid month in Khalouia, Algeria, with an average temperature ranging between max 35°C (95°F) and min 24.7°C (76.5°F).

Heat index

During August, the heat index is estimated at a very hot 39°C (102.2°F). Implement additional safety measures to avoid heat cramps and heat exhaustion. Persistent activity might trigger heatstroke.
It is important to note that the heat index values are for shaded areas and light wind scenarios. A rise of up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ees in the heat index could result from direct sunlight.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'felt air temperature' or 'real feel', is derived by integrating air temperature with the existing relative humidity to express the perceived warmth. This effect is personal, influenced by the individual's physical activity and heat sensitivity, shaped by factors including wind, attire, and metabolic variations. Direct exposure to sun rays can potentially augment the heat sensation, elevating the heat index by up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are especially crucial for babies and toddlers. Kids often lack the knowledge about the necessity to take breaks and consume liquids. Thirst, as a late symptom of dehydration, necessitates the maintenance of hydration, particularly during enduring physical activities.
Normally, the human body cools itself through perspiration, which removes excessive heat by evaporating sweat. In situations of high air temperature combined with high humidity (significant heat index), the body's ability to perspire is reduced, heightening the sense of warmth. If the body retains more heat than it can expel, the increasing temperature can lead to heat-related conditions.

Humidity

In Khalouia, the average relative humidity in August is 46%.

Rainfall

August is the month with the least rainfall in Khalouia. Rain falls for 3.5 days and accumulates 5mm (0.2") of precipitation.

Snowfall

March through December are months without snowfall in Khalouia.

Daylight

In August, the average length of the day is 13h and 28min.
On the first day of August, sunrise is at 06:07 and sunset at 20:02.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 06:30 and sunset at 19:27 CET.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in August in Khalouia is 9.9h.

UV index

In Khalouia, the average daily maximum UV index in August is 7. A UV Index reading of 6 to 7 represents a high health risk from exposure to the Sun's UV radiation for the average person.
Note: The maximum UV index of 7 during August leads to these instructions:
Enforce precautions and stick to sun safety measures. Preservation from skin and eye damage is essential. Make an effort to avoid direct sun exposure between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m., the peak period for UV radiation, and note that objects like parasols or canopies might not offer full sun protection. Equip yourself with UVA and UVB-filtering sunglasses on clear, sunny days.
